Traditional Catholic House Blessing Prayer

- A traditional Catholic house blessing typically involves holy water, the sign of the cross, Scripture reading, and a formal prayer of dedication.
- A priest or deacon is usually invited to lead the blessing but any faithful Catholic can pray a sincere blessing over their own home.
- Whether you have just moved into a new home or have lived in the same house for many years, a formal house blessing is always a meaningful and powerful act of faith.
- The blessing typically moves from room to room, asking God’s specific grace over each space and its purpose.
- In the bedroom, the prayer asks God to protect those who rest there, that they may rest in the peace of Christ and wake refreshed and renewed.
- This tradition connects your home to a long and unbroken line of Christian families who have invited God’s blessing over their households throughout history.
- The formal nature of the Catholic house blessing gives it a sense of sacred weight and sincere spiritual significance.

Epiphany House Blessing Prayer (2026 Special)

- The Epiphany house blessing invites Christ to fill the home with His light so that the family’s concern for others may reflect God’s love to the world around them.
- Traditionally, families write the letters C, M, B and the year above their front door with blessed chalk as a sign of dedication and protection.
- The letters CMB stand for both the names of the three kings — Caspar, Melchior, and Balthasar — and the Latin phrase meaning “May Christ bless this house.”
- For 2026 the inscription above the door would read: 20 + C + M + B + 26 — a symbol of faith, blessing, and God’s protection over your home.
- The Epiphany blessing asks that those living in the house use their talents and abilities to God’s greater glory throughout the new year.
- This tradition is over one thousand years old and connects your family to a beautiful worldwide community of faith doing the same thing on the same day.

How to Bless Your Home on the Feast of Epiphany
- Choose the day of Epiphany — January 6th — or the Sunday closest to it to perform your home blessing.
- Gather blessed chalk from your local Catholic church or any white chalk you have at home for the door inscription.
- Begin with a short prayer of gratitude for God’s protection over your home in the previous year.
- Write the Epiphany inscription above your front door: 20+C+M+B+26 — a declaration of faith and blessing for 2026.
- Read a passage of Scripture together — Luke 19:1-9 or Matthew 2:1-12 are both excellent choices that connect the blessing to the Epiphany story.
- Pray through each room of the house asking for God’s specific grace over that space and its purpose.
- Close with the Lord’s Prayer together as a family and seal the blessing with the sign of the cross.

Home Blessing with Bread, Salt, and Wine
Many Christian and Jewish traditions use bread, salt, and wine as symbolic elements of a home blessing. Each carries deep spiritual meaning rooted in Scripture and ancient tradition.
- Bread represents nourishment and God’s provision — blessing your home with bread declares that no one under this roof will ever go without what they need.
- Salt represents preservation, purity, and flavour — it is a symbol of the covenant God makes with His people and a declaration against decay and corruption.
- Wine represents joy, celebration, and the blood of Jesus — blessing your home with wine declares that joy will be a permanent guest in your household.
- These three elements together cover the physical, spiritual, and relational dimensions of a home that is truly blessed.
- This tradition is practiced across many cultures and faith communities and continues to bring meaning and beauty to new home blessings worldwide.
